Our analysis found Purdue University Global to be the most popular school for healthcare students who want to pursue a basic certificate in the Great Lakes Region . Located in Indianapolis, Indiana, the large public school handed out 933 basic certificate awards in 2020-2021.
The average in-state tuition and fees for students at Purdue University Global is $10,125. Those students who come from outside the state pay an average of $14,436. Of those students who received their degree, 79% were women.
Interested in an online degree? Then you definitely want to check out Purdue University Global. Every undergraduate student at the school took at least one class online.
The excellent basic certificate programs at Sinclair Community College helped the school earn the #2 place on this year’s ranking of the most popular healthcare schools in the Great Lakes Region . Located in Dayton, Ohio, the fairly large public school awarded 901 diplomas to qualifed basic certificate students in 2020-2021.
The average in-state tuition and fees for students at Sinclair Community College is $4,329. If you are from out of state, expect to pay an average of $8,076. Around 73% of those degree recipients were women.
In 2019-2020 about 80% of the undergraduate students at the school chose to take one or more online courses.
